Hi Marza,

Quick handover before I'm out. Parity work between the Quellio Android and desktop SDKs is nearly done — only batch upload callbacks differ now. Cut the release once Torvin merges his fix, then sign both artifacts in one pass. Everything else is green. The signing key you'll need is right here.

deploy key for kajof-fajop: bky6_gDHw9Q

Quick note on the Inkmill markdown pipeline: documents get sanitized, parsed, and rendered server-side by the Quillforge service, then cached for ten minutes. Nothing fancy, but watch the sanitizer allowlist — raw HTML is stripped unless the caller has the embed scope. Review calls hit the staging renderer, which authenticates with the internal key provided right below this paragraph.

app token of bawep-hafog = kto7_vwrmnlx

*
 * Security note: this constant caps worst-case CPU time per scheduling
 * request. Lowering it risks incomplete timetables; raising it exposes
 * the endpoint to resource-exhaustion abuse, since requests are not yet
 * rate-limited upstream. Any change requires sign-off from the platform
 * review board and a load test against the Marwood staging cluster.
 * Changes must reference the build token recorded below.
 */

pipeline stamp: htk31_f769b577b3028a4e9958e5bb8d1259a